A gunman opened fire at Marjory Stoneman Douglas High school in Parkland, Fla., on Wednesday, officials there said. According to the Broward County Sheriff’s Office, there were multiple fatalities and at least 14 people were injured. ISLAMABAD — A grand annual military parade marking Pakistan’s Republic Day has for the first time involved Chinese troops, underscoring Beijing’s increasingly strong partnership with Islamabad. The Pakistan military displayed its conventional and nuclear-capable weapons at Thursday’s parade in the capital, where security was extremely tight. Authorities blocked cellular phone networks to deter militants, who have often used mobile phone signals to trigger bombs. Pakistan Day commemorates March 23, 1940, when a resolution was passed to demand the establishment of a separate homeland to protect Muslims in the then British colony of India.
